Federal and State Minimum Wages Impact

In the United States, the federal minimum wage stands at $7.25 per hour, a figure that has remained unchanged since 2009. However, various states and some cities have established their own minimum wages that Subway must follow. For example, in states such as Washington and California, the minimum wage is much higher than the federal level, meaning that Subway employees in those areas can anticipate starting at these elevated hourly rates.

Variation by Role and Experience

At Subway, like most fast-food joints, not every position pays the same. Here’s a breakdown of different roles and their typical How Much Does Subway Pay an Hour :

  • Sandwich Artists: The most common role at Subway, which involves food preparation and customer service, usually pays around minimum wage. However, employees can earn more with experience or if they work in areas with a higher cost of living.
  • Shift Managers: Employees in these roles usually earn a bit more as they take on additional responsibilities like managing staff and handling opening or closing duties.
  • Store Managers: The compensation for this role is significantly higher and often salaried, reflecting the extensive experience and management skills required.

Real-Life Examples What Subway Employees Say

To give you a better understanding of what to expect when working at Subway, we’ve compiled insights from various employees across different states:

  • California: How Much Does Subway Pay an Hour in California ? With a state minimum wage of $14.00 per hour (as of 2021), Subway sandwich artists here report starting at this rate, with some earning up to $16.00 per hour with added responsibilities.
  • Texas: How Much Does Subway Pay an Hour in Texas ? The state adheres to the federal minimum wage, but Subway workers have reported hourly rates ranging from $7.25 to $10.00, depending largely on the specific location and their role.
  • New York: How Much Does Subway Pay an Hour in New York ? Known for its high cost of living, Subway employees in New York City often start at around $15.00 per hour, aligning with the city’s aggressive minimum wage standards.

Benefits and Perks

While hourly pay is an important aspect of employee compensation, Subway also provides a range of benefits that can play a vital role in your overall employment package. These benefits may encompass health insurance, paid time off, employee discounts, and flexible scheduling, which is especially attractive to students and part-time workers.

Opportunities for Advancement

An important aspect to think about is the possibility of salary growth and career advancement. Numerous Subway workers begin their journey as sandwich artists and can progress to managerial roles, which offer higher pay and more extensive benefits. This career path can greatly influence an individual’s earning potential in the long run.
